CORNED BEEF SALAD

Years ago, the ladies of our church would have "tasting bees" where you would pay a small price to taste a new recipe that was made by one of them. This was their way to make money for the church. Number Of Ingredients 6

1 3 oz pkg. lemon jello
1-1/2 c hot water
2 c celery, chopped
1/4 c onion, chopped
1 c mayonnaise
1 can(s) corned beef

Steps:

  • 1. Mix Jello and hot water. When Jello is partly gelled, add celery and onion.
  • 2. Mix mayonnaise and corned beef; add to Jello.
  • 3. Pour into a 9x13 pan and let stand overnight in refrigerator. Cut in squares and serve.
